First off, let's talk about why ventilation is so important. When you're dealing with stone mining equipment, there are a bunch of harmful things in the air. Dust is a major issue. Stone dust can be really bad for your health if you breathe it in. It can cause all sorts of respiratory problems, like silicosis, which is a serious and sometimes irreversible lung disease. Also, the equipment itself gives off exhaust fumes. Diesel - powered machinery, for example, releases pollutants such as carbon monoxide, nitrogen oxides, and particulate matter. These fumes are not only bad for the workers' health but can also create an explosive environment if they build up too much.
Airflow Requirements
One of the most basic requirements for a ventilation system is proper airflow. You need to make sure that fresh air is constantly being brought into the area around the stone mining equipment and that the contaminated air is being removed. A good rule of thumb is to have an airflow rate that can completely replace the air in the working area at least 6 - 8 times per hour. This might seem like a lot, but it's necessary to keep the air clean and safe.
To achieve this airflow, you need to install fans and ducts correctly. The fans should be powerful enough to move the required volume of air. For larger mining operations with multiple pieces of heavy - duty equipment, you might need industrial - grade fans. These fans can generate a high - volume airflow, pushing the stale air out and pulling in fresh air. Ducts are used to direct the airflow. They should be properly sized and sealed to prevent air leakage. If there are leaks in the ducts, the efficiency of the ventilation system will drop significantly.


Filtration
Filtration is another key requirement. The ventilation system should be equipped with high - quality filters to remove dust and other particulate matter from the air. There are different types of filters available, and the choice depends on the size of the particles you're trying to capture. For stone mining, HEPA (High - Efficiency Particulate Air) filters are often a good choice. These filters can capture particles as small as 0.3 microns with an efficiency of 99.97%.
However, just having a good filter isn't enough. You also need to maintain it properly. Filters need to be regularly checked and replaced when they get clogged. A clogged filter restricts airflow, which can lead to a build - up of contaminants in the air. Some ventilation systems are designed with indicator lights or sensors to let you know when the filter needs to be changed.
Monitoring and Control
It's essential to have a system in place to monitor and control the ventilation. You can install air quality sensors around the stone mining equipment. These sensors can measure things like dust concentration, levels of carbon monoxide, and other pollutants. By continuously monitoring the air quality, you can adjust the ventilation system as needed.
For example, if the dust concentration starts to rise, you can increase the fan speed or turn on additional fans. On the other hand, if the air quality is good, you can reduce the power consumption of the ventilation system to save energy. Some modern ventilation systems can be connected to a central control panel, allowing operators to monitor and control the system remotely.
Safety Considerations
Safety is always a top priority. The ventilation system should be designed to prevent any potential hazards. Electrical components of the fans and control systems should be properly insulated and grounded to avoid electrical shocks. Also, the ventilation system should be protected against damage from the stone mining equipment itself. For example, ducts should be placed in a way that they won't be hit by moving machinery.
In case of an emergency, such as a fire or a sudden increase in pollutant levels, the ventilation system should have an emergency shutdown feature. This ensures that the system can be quickly stopped to prevent the spread of fire or the further circulation of dangerous fumes.
Adaptability
Stone mining operations can vary greatly in size, layout, and the type of equipment used. So, the ventilation system needs to be adaptable. It should be easy to modify and expand as the mining operation grows or changes. For example, if you add more stone mining equipment, you might need to increase the airflow capacity of the ventilation system. A modular ventilation system is a great option in this case. It allows you to add or remove components as needed without a major overhaul of the entire system.
Integration with Other Systems
The ventilation system should also be integrated with other safety and operational systems in the mining area. For example, it can be linked to the fire suppression system. In the event of a fire, the ventilation system can be adjusted to help remove smoke and fumes while preventing the spread of fire. It can also be integrated with the lighting system. Proper lighting is important for workers to see clearly, and the ventilation system can help remove heat generated by the lights, preventing overheating.
